High-risk individuals
Certain groups are at an increased risk for getting the flu and developing potentially dangerous flu-related complications. It’s important that people in these high-risk groups be vaccinated.
According to the CDC, these individuals include:
-
pregnant women and women up to 2 weeks after pregnancy
-
children between 6 months and 5 years of age
-
people 18 and under who receive aspirin therapy
-
people over 65
-
anyone with chronic medical conditions
-
people whose body mass index (BMI) is 40 or higher
-
American Indians or Alaska Natives
